HERA Radio-TeleScope II期的新宽带Vivaldi Feed的设计
Design of the New Wideband Vivaldi Feed for the HERA Radio-Telescope Phase II

本文介绍了针对电离阵列(HERA)无线电镜的新的双极化Vivaldi饲料的设计。该宽带进料是为了替代I期偶极子进料的开发,用于照亮直径14米的盘子。它旨在通过允许从宇宙黎明以及电离时代表征红移的21 cm氢信号来提高HERA的科学能力。这是通过将带宽从100-200 MHz增加到50-250 MHz来实现的,从而优化了天线接收器系统的时间响应并提高其灵敏度。这种新的Vivaldi进料直接由放置在圆形腔内的差分前端模块,并通过锥形插槽中间的电缆连接到后端。我们表明,这种特定的配置对辐射模式和系统响应的影响很小。
This paper presents the design of a new dual-polarised Vivaldi feed for the Hydrogen Epoch of Reionization Array (HERA) radio-telescope. This wideband feed has been developed to replace the Phase I dipole feed, and is used to illuminate a 14-m diameter dish. It aims to improve the science capabilities of HERA, by allowing it to characterise the redshifted 21-cm hydrogen signal from the Cosmic Dawn as well as from the Epoch of Reionization. This is achieved by increasing the bandwidth from 100 -- 200 MHz to 50 -- 250 MHz, optimising the time response of the antenna - receiver system, and improving its sensitivity. This new Vivaldi feed is directly fed by a differential front-end module placed inside the circular cavity and connected to the back-end via cables which pass in the middle of the tapered slot. We show that this particular configuration has minimal effects on the radiation pattern and on the system response.
